runtime: use _libgo_off_t_type when calling C mmap
The last argument to the C mmap function is type off_t, not uintptr. On some 32-bit systems, off_t is larger than uintptr. Based on patch by Sören Tempel. Reviewed-on: https://go-review.googlesource.com/c/gofrontend/+/445735
